Du kan bruke PHP til å trekke ut detaljer om en server -protokoll , slik at du kan aktivere koden bestemt til serverens versjon . En vanlig bruk er å oppdage om side kjører standard HTTP eller sikre HTTPS . Informasjon om serverens protokollen er lagret i superglobal variabel array " $ _SERVER ", som du kan få tilgang til hvor som helst i skriptet . Instruksjoner
en
Åpne din PHP kilde filen i en teksteditor , for eksempel Windows Notepad
2
bruk ". $ _SERVER [' SERVER_NAME ' ]; " for å få tilgang til navnet på serveren vert som PHP kjører . For eksempel , "echo $ _SERVER [' SERVER_NAME '] ; " " . Www.myserver.com " kan vise en streng som
3
Bruk " $ _SERVER [' SERVER_SOFTWARE '] ; "for å få tilgang til serveren identifisering strengen , som vises i overskrifter. For eksempel , "echo $ _SERVER [' SERVER_SOFTWARE ' ]; " kan vise en streng som
4
Bruk " $ _SERVER [' SERVER_PROTOCOL '] " Apache/2.2.3 ( CentOS ) . " ; "for å få tilgang til revisjon og navnet på den informasjonen som brukes for den forespurte siden . For eksempel , "echo $ _SERVER [' SERVER_PROTOCOL ' ]; " kan vise en streng som
5
Lagre PHP-filen og laste den opp på serveren din for å sørge for at det " HTTP/1.1 . " fungerer ordentlig .